ServerGroupCollection Members

The ServerGroupCollection class represents a collection of ServerGroup objects that represent all the server groups on the server group.

The following tables list the members exposed by the ServerGroupCollection type.

Protected Fields

  Name Description
ms220085.protfield(en-US,SQL.90).gif initialized  (inherited from RegSvrCollectionBase )
ms220085.protfield(en-US,SQL.90).gif innerColl  (inherited from RegSvrCollectionBase )

Top

Public Properties

  Name Description
ms220085.pubproperty(en-US,SQL.90).gif Count Gets the number of objects in the referenced collection.
ms220085.pubproperty(en-US,SQL.90).gif IsSynchronized  Gets a Boolean value indicating whether access to the collection is synchronized and therefore thread-safe. (inherited from RegSvrCollectionBase)
ms220085.pubproperty(en-US,SQL.90).gif Item Overloaded. Gets a ServerGroup object in the collection by name or by index number.
ms220085.pubproperty(en-US,SQL.90).gif Parent Gets the ServerGroup object that is the parent of the ServerGroupCollection object.
ms220085.pubproperty(en-US,SQL.90).gif SyncRoot  Gets an object that can be used to synchronize access to the collection. (inherited from RegSvrCollectionBase)

Top

Public Methods

(see also Protected Methods )

  Name Description
ms220085.pubmethod(en-US,SQL.90).gif Add Adds a ServerGroup object to the ServerGroupCollection collection.
ms220085.pubmethod(en-US,SQL.90).gif Contains Determines whether the specified string value exists within the collection.
ms220085.pubmethod(en-US,SQL.90).gif CopyTo Copies the collection objects to a one-dimensional array beginning at the index value specified.
ms220085.pubmethod(en-US,SQL.90).gif Equals  Overloaded. (inherited from Object )
ms220085.pubmethod(en-US,SQL.90).gif GetEnumerator Returns an IEnumerator interface that lets you iterate through the objects in the collection.
ms220085.pubmethod(en-US,SQL.90).gif GetHashCode  (inherited from Object )
ms220085.pubmethod(en-US,SQL.90).gif GetType  (inherited from Object )
ms220085.pubmethod(en-US,SQL.90).gifms220085.static(en-US,SQL.90).gif ReferenceEquals  (inherited from Object )
ms220085.pubmethod(en-US,SQL.90).gif Remove Removes a ServerGroup object from the ServerGroupCollection object.
ms220085.pubmethod(en-US,SQL.90).gif ToString  (inherited from Object )

Top

Protected Methods

  Name Description
ms220085.protmethod(en-US,SQL.90).gif Finalize  (inherited from Object )
ms220085.protmethod(en-US,SQL.90).gif MemberwiseClone  (inherited from Object )

Top

See Also

Reference

ServerGroupCollection Class
Microsoft.SqlServer.Management.Smo.RegisteredServers Namespace

Other Resources

Using Collections